Hoshizaki America, Inc. Announces Chris Karssiens as President of the Americas Region

Hoshizaki Corporation has appointed Chris Karssiens to the new role of president of the Americas region. He will serve in this role concurrently with his current position as president of Hoshizaki America. Karssiens joined Hoshizaki America, Inc. in the beginning of 2020 as SVP of sales & marketing. He has held leadership roles in several foodservice organizations including Scotsman Industries, Enodis, Welbilt, Standex, and Middleby, and spent seven years managing both Enodis and Welbilt APAC (Asia-Pacific).

“Uniting the Americas region…is a key strategy for Hoshizaki Group worldwide,” states Mr. Yasuhiro Kobayashi, President & COO, Hoshizaki Corporation in Japan. “I believe that our company presidents in this region have the needed global enterprise perspective, strength and vision to lead their teams to be successful in this effort.”

The team consists of Matthew Whitener, recently appointed president of Lancer Worldwide, Carlos Storniolo, president of AÇOS Macom, and Jonathan Akin, president of Jackson WWS. Last week Chris shared with his new team, “I am excited to work directly with each of you as we embark on the important work of delivering value to our industry through improved efficiencies. Synergistic opportunities across our multi-brand team will allow us to achieve our primary goal of exceeding the expectations of our customers, our channel partners, our people, and our shareholders.”
